Aneurin Bevan University Health Board in Newport is hiring for a substantive post in the Neurophysiology Directorate. The role involves providing comprehensive neurophysiology services for both inpatients and outpatients at St Woolos Hospital, including EEG and Evoked Potentials.
Candidates must hold full registration with the General Medical Council and achieve specialist registration as a consultant within six months of the interview.
The position offers a salary ranging from £114,099 to £166,585 annually, pro rata.
